// Client setup for the Harrowmede partner SFTP drop.
// Partner files land hourly in the inbound directory; this client
// polls the Coppervale transfer-broker service rather than the SFTP
// host directly, so we inherit the broker's checksum verification and
// duplicate-file suppression. Connection retries are capped at three
// to avoid hammering the partner endpoint during their maintenance
// window. The broker requires an internal API key, set below.

gateway credential: kto23_LX9A4ys6i4nzHtpOLNLodKK

Subject: Legacy Pricing Adjustment

Team — effective next quarter, legacy Fernholt Plan customers move to current rates, capped at a 12% uplift. Roughly 3,400 accounts affected, mostly in the Darrowfield region. Expect churn of 4–6%; retention offers are pre-approved at branch level within the standard matrix. Notifications go out in two waves. Branch managers should brief front-line staff this week and escalate only contract disputes. Rationale and forward plan are set out below.

management briefing: Project Ulavan slips by two quarters because of the staffing delay.

Handover for the Larkspur Hall audio-guide app, prepared for the release manager. Version 4.2 bundles the new offline tour packs; they're signed at build time, so any asset change requires a full repack. The stop-detection beacons were recalibrated last month — do not ship the old calibration file still sitting in `assets/legacy`. Release checklist lives in `docs/ship.md`; accessibility captions must pass review before store submission. To sign the production build, unlock the signing keystore with the passphrase below.

unlock words, fafop-hawep: briwyn-oliix-sorox